TIA TSB-62-20

Enhanced Bandwidth Performance over Laser-Based, Multimode Fiber Local Area Networks

active, Most Current
Buy Now
Organization: TIA
Publication Date: 1 November 2007
Status: active
Page Count: 29
scope:

Although the methodology described here to characterize both sources and fiber may be broadly applicable to different source and fiber types, the specific selection criteria addressed in this bulletin are only applicable to LANs based on short-wavelength (830 - 860 nm) laser sources and graded-index 62.5/125 m optical fibers. Short-wavelength networks based on graded-index 50/125 m fiber alread perform at gigabit-per-second data rates over link lengths of up to 550 meters; criteria for enhanced network performance is therefore less urgent for these networks. Nevertheless, enhanced network performance for 50/125 m fiber systems (e.g.10 gigabit-per-second systems) is currently (as of September 2000) under consideration in the Working Group.
